This Book Is The Historical Documentation Of The Women Who Braved The Colonial Rulers Of India And Committed Themselves To The Fight For The Freedom Of The Country. They Were Focused On Only One Goal-The Freedom Of The Country. Annie Besant, Sarojini Naidu, Aruna Asaf Ali, Vijaya Lakshmi Pandit, Madame Bhikaji Cama And Margaret Cousins, Who Were Among The Early Pioneers Of The Women'S Nationalist Movement In India, Inspired Thousands Of Other Women, And Also Men, To Take Up Cudgels Against The British. Their Fight Was For Freedom And In This Historic Struggle, The Role Of Women In The Nationalist Movement Cannot Be Underplayed. The Editors Have Conducted Intensive Research In Archival Records And Historical Documents To Present A Living Record Of The Activities Of The Brave Women Who Participated In The Nationalist Movement. This book, significantly, focuses on the nationalist participation of ordinary middle-class women in India’s freedom movement, especially in the United Provinces (modern Uttar Pradesh). To construct the nationalist narrative of unheard voices, the author goes beyond conventional sources of history such as official and archival records. Instead, she employs a diverse range of materials-including oral narratives, poetry, cartoons, vernacular magazines, and private correspondence-in order to let these women speak for themselves.
